In response to the recent election fiasco, progressives are increasing their efforts to control the internet. They are targeting fake news. Since no one is in favor of fake news, this should be a clear winning strategy. Progressives can portray themselves as the defenders of democracy and free speech. At the same time they will be able to eliminate some troublesome competitors who might question their own reliability.
The forces arrayed against the powers of falsehood are formidable. They include heads of state, internet providers, major news organizations, and a myriad of private groups. President Obama proclaimed, There has to be, I think, some sort of way in which we can sort through information that passes some basic truthiness tests and those that we have to discard because they just dont have any basis in anything thats actually happening in the world. This is a curious statement since truthiness is defined as the quality of seeming to be true according to one's intuition, opinion, or perception without regard to logic, factual evidence, or the like. Angela Merkel told the German Bundestag, Opinions aren't formed the way they were 25 years ago. We must confront this phenomenon and if necessary, regulate it."
